WINDOW ROCK, Ariz. — The 25th Navajo Nation Council will convene for a special session on March 26, 2024, at 10 am (MDT) at the Navajo Nation Council Chamber in Window Rock, Ariz., to consider Legislation No. 0067-24 to comply with the U.S. Treasury’s obligation deadlines and Legislation No. 0020-24, approving the almost $1 million from the Unreserved, Undesignated Fund Balance for the Navajo Election Administration for its expenses in preparation for the 2024 Navajo Nation elections.

Resolution No. CJY-41-21, Section Seven, established that Navajo Nation Fiscal Recovery Funding allocated for central support services and regulatory services will automatically revert to the NNFRF if not expended by March 31.

The U.S. Treasury’s Nov. 9 Interim Final Rule on Obligation of FRF, authorized the use and expenditure of FRF for personnel costs and other operating costs after the obligation deadline (Dec. 31) when the use and expenditure are related to compliance with federal laws, regulations, and the funding agreement.

To ensure that the Navajo Nation takes full advantage of all opportunities to expend NNFRF on costs deemed FRF eligible under U.S. Treasury rules and guidance, the 25th Navajo Nation Council will consider amending CHY-41-21 to comply with the U.S. Treasury’s rules and guidance, including the obligation and expenditure deadlines.
